In the fast-paced world of finance, the constant evolution of technology shapes how we manage our money. SMS banking software has emerged as a vital tool for financial institutions, dramatically changing how we interact with our banks. With the increasing penetration of mobile technology, SMS banking is not just an alternative but a significant medium for transaction and service communications. This blog post delves into SMS banking software development and its implications for the future of banking.
The Rise of SMS Banking
As more people gain access to mobile phones, the potential for banking services through SMS has surged. According to recent statistics, over 5 billion people use mobile phones globally. This figure presents an enormous market for SMS banking solutions, making it imperative for financial institutions to adapt and innovate. The simplicity of SMS banking makes it accessible for users who may not have smartphones or stable internet access, ensuring a wider reach.
Key Features of SMS Banking
Before we dive deeper into the development aspects, let’s discuss some key features that make SMS banking a preferred choice for many customers:
- Account Information: Customers can receive real-time account balances and transaction histories effortlessly.
- Transaction Alerts: Banks can send notifications about important transactions or suspicious activities, thereby enhancing security.
- Fund Transfers: Users can initiate fund transfers simply by sending an SMS, offering unparalleled convenience.
- Bill Payments: Customers can pay bills directly through SMS, saving time and reducing the need to visit physical branches.
Benefits of SMS Banking Software Development
Developing SMS banking software brings numerous benefits for financial institutions:
1. Enhanced Customer Experience
By providing users with instant access to banking services through mobile devices, banks can improve the overall customer experience. Faster responses and simplified processes lead to higher customer satisfaction.
2. Reduced Operational Costs
SMS banking can help minimize operational costs associated with traditional banking. Lower transaction processing costs can make services more cost-effective for both banks and customers.
3. Improved Security
SMS banking solutions can include two-factor authentication and alerts for suspicious activities, reducing the risk of fraud and ensuring a safer banking environment.
Challenges in SMS Banking Software Development
Despite its advantages, developing SMS banking software is not without challenges. Developers must contend with varying regulations in different regions, ensuring compliance and protecting user data. Moreover, integrating SMS banking with existing banking infrastructure can present technical hurdles.
1. Regulatory Compliance
Every country has its own set of regulations regarding digital financial services. Developers must ensure that their SMS banking solutions comply with the respective laws to avoid legal repercussions.
2. Security Concerns
As SMS is not entirely secure from interception, developing strong encryption methods and secure protocols is crucial to protect sensitive information transmitted via SMS.
3. Technological Integration
Integrating SMS banking with existing systems may require substantial technical resources. Ensuring smooth communication between various banking platforms and SMS gateways is essential for seamless service delivery.
The Development Process of SMS Banking Software
Creating effective SMS banking software entails a well-planned development process. Below are key steps involved:
1. Requirement Analysis
The first step is to conduct a thorough analysis of user requirements, market trends, and regulatory needs. Understanding the target audience is essential in tailoring features that meet their needs.
2. Designing the User Interface
Even though it primarily involves SMS, how the interaction is designed matters. A clear, user-friendly approach ensures customers can easily navigate through options using simple text interactions.
3. Selecting Technology Stack
The choice of programming languages, frameworks, and databases affects the performance and scalability of the application. Selecting the right SMS gateway is also crucial for sending and receiving messages.
4. Development and Testing
Developers start coding based on the design specifications. Rigorous testing follows to ensure all features function correctly under various scenarios to provide high reliability.
5. Implementation and Maintenance
Once tested, the software is deployed. Maintenance becomes an ongoing process, as regular updates and security assessments are essential to keep the software optimal and safe.
Future Trends in SMS Banking Software Development
The financial landscape is undergoing radical change, and SMS banking is poised for further evolution:
1. AI and Machine Learning
Integrating AI can enhance customer interactions by providing personalized recommendations and automating responses to common queries via SMS.
2. Blockchain Technology
The use of blockchain could enhance security and transparency in transactions, coupled with SMS banking services, enabling a new level of trust and efficiency.
3. Multi-language Support
As financial institutions expand globally, multilingual SMS banking solutions will become essential to cater to diverse user bases.
Conclusion
The evolution of SMS banking software development represents a significant leap towards making financial services more accessible, secure, and user-friendly. As technology progresses, banks must embrace innovations that enhance customer experiences while addressing the challenges of security and regulatory compliance. In an increasingly digital world, SMS banking stands out as a crucial tool for financial inclusivity, ensuring everyone can access essential banking services right from their mobile devices.







